/*@import url('https://fonts.googleapis.com/css2?family=Barlow+Condensed:ital,wght@0,300;0,400;0,500;0,600;0,700;0,800;1,300;1,400;1,500;1,600;1,700;1,800&family=Roboto:ital,wght@0,300;0,400;0,500;0,700;1,300;1,400;1,500;1,700&display=swap');*/
@import url('https://fonts.googleapis.com/css2?family=Roboto:ital,wght@0,300;0,400;0,500;0,700;0,900;1,300;1,400;1,500;1,700;1,900&family=Signika:wght@300;400;500;600;700&display=swap');
:root{
 --cinza:#CCCCCC;
 --cinza-medio:#737272;
 --preto:#000;
 --branco:#FFF;
 --bege:#fdf7f1;
 --bege-medio:#f4eae1;
 --laranja:#f04e34;
 --azul:#5c91c5;
 --vermelho:#bc1a00;
 --amarelo:#fdbc33;
}

*{box-sizing:border-box;}html,body{font-family:'Roboto',sans-serif;letter-spacing:1px;}
html{scroll-behavior:smooth;}
body{margin:142px 0px 0px;padding:0px;}img{max-width:100%;max-height:auto;}a{color:inherit;text-decoration:none;}h1,h2,h3,h4{margin:0px 0px 15px;}p{margin:0px 0px 10px;}
.fontBase{font-family:'Roboto',sans-serif;}/*.fontBase2{font-family:'Barlow Condensed', sans-serif;}*/
.fontBase2{font-family:'Signika',sans-serif;}
.font-size11{font-size:11px;}.font-size12{font-size:12px;}.font-size14{font-size:14px;}.font-size16{font-size:16px;}.font-size17{font-size:17px;}.font-size18{font-size:18px;}.font-size20{font-size:20px;}.font-size22{font-size:22px;}.font-size25{font-size:25px;}.font-size28{font-size:28px;}.font-size32{font-size:32px;}.font-size40{font-size:40px;}.font-size45{font-size:45px;}.font-size50{font-size:50px;}.font-size60{font-size:60px;}
.txt-left{text-align:left;}.txt-right{text-align:right;}.txt-center{text-align:center;}.txt-justify{text-align:justify;}	
.font-300{font-weight:300;}.font-400{font-weight:400;}.font-500{font-weight:500;}.font-600{font-weight:600;}.font-700{font-weight:700;}.font-900{font-weight:900;}
*[class*="wd-"]{max-width:100%;}
*[class*="flex-content-"]{display:flex;}
.justify-between{justify-content:space-between;}.justify-center{justify-content:center;}.justify-around{justify-content:space-around;}.justify-end{justify-content:flex-end;}
.flex-wrap{flex-wrap:wrap;}.flex-nowrap{flex-wrap:nowrap;}
.align-item-center{align-items:center;}
.wd-1200{width:1200px;}.wd-1100{width:1100px;}.wd-1000{width:1000px;}.wd-900{width:900px;}.wd-800{width:800px;}.wd-700{width:700px;}.wd-600{width:600px;}.wd-500{width:500px;}.wd-400{width:400px;}.wd-350{width:350px;}.wd-300{width:300px;}.wd-200{width:200px;}.wd-150{width:150px;}.wd-120{width:120px;}.wd-90{width:90px;}.wd-60{width:60px;}.wd-32{width:32px;}
.margin-auto{margin:auto;}.margin-zero{margin:0px;}.lista-zero,.lista-zero-margem{list-style:none;margin:0px;padding:0px;}.lista-zero-margem li{margin-bottom:20px;}.margin-bottom12{margin-bottom:12px;}
.ht-32{height:32px;}.ht-60{height:60px;}.ht-90{height:90px;}.ht-120{height:120px;}.ht-200{height:200px;}.ht-250{height:250px;}
.divisor{margin:12px auto;height:2px;overflow:hidden;}
header{position:fixed;top:0px;left:0px;width:100%;background-color:rgba(255,255,255,0.7);}
.MenuMob{padding:5px 8px;border-radius:8px;background-color:var(--laranja);align-self:center;background-image:url(../images/icones/menu.svg);background-repeat:no-repeat;background-size:70%;width:32px;height:32px;background-position:center center;position: relative;z-index:0;}
.MenuMob,.closebt{display:none;}
.MenuMob::after{content:'';display:none;}
#logomarca{width:120px;}

.nav-wrapper,.redes-top{align-self:center;}
.nav{list-style:none;margin:0px;padding:5px;display:flex;justify-content:center;align-items:center;}
.nav-item{padding:4px 12px;color:var(--preto);font-weight:500;ext-shadow: 2px 2px 2px rgba(0,0,0,1);}
.nav-item:hover{color:var(--amarelo);text-decoration:underline;}
.redes-top{display:flex;}
.redes-top img{width:32px;margin:2px 4px;}
.flex-content-header{padding:15px 25px;}
.Main-Img{background-color:var(--laranja);display:flex;justify-content:center;align-items:center;overflow:hidden;}
.Main-Img div.flex-content-maintop{order:1;width:60%;}
.Main-Img div:nth-child(2){order:2;width:40%;}
.Main-Img div:nth-child(2) img{margin-bottom:-5px;}
.Main-label{padding:8px 20px;color:var(--branco);text-shadow: 2px 2px 2px rgba(0, 0, 0, 1);}
.Main-Img2{width:100%;height:800px;background-image:url(/site/images/bg-main4.jpg);display:flex;justify-content:center;align-items:center;background-repeat:no-repeat;background-position:center center;background-size:cover;margin-bottom:25px;}
#mainimg{display:inline-block;}
.img-coxinha{display:block;}
#mainimg-mob,.redes-mob{display:none;}
section{padding:30px 25px;}
.bt-branco,.bt-laranja,.bt-vermelho,.bt{border:solid 1px;padding:8px 22px;border-radius:40px;font-family:'Signika',sans-serif;font-weight:600;text-transform:uppercase;display:inline-block;}
.bt-laranja{color:var(--laranja);border-color:var(--laranja);}
.bt-branco{color:var(--branco);border-color:var(--branco);}
.bt-laranja:hover{color:var(--branco);background-color:var(--laranja);}
.bt-branco:hover{color:var(--preto);background-color:var(--branco);text-shadow: none;}
.bt-vermelho{color:var(--vermelho);border-color:var(--vermelho);}
.bt-vermelho:hover{color:var(--branco);background-color:var(--vermelho);}
.zaphover:hover{background-color:#0C3;color:var(--branco);}
.cardapio-box{width:340px;max-width:98%;margin-bottom:20px;background-color:var(--bege-medio);}
.cardapio-label{padding:8px 5px 2px;font-family:'Signika',sans-serif; font-weight:500;font-size:18px;margin-top:-5px;}
.cardapio-label::first-letter{text-transform: uppercase;}
.cardapio-label-txt{font-size:12px;padding:5px 10px 15px;text-align:left}
.flex-content-cardapio-wrapper{width:90%;margin:auto 0px;}
footer{background-color:#36140e;width:100%;}
.flex-content-footer{padding:15px 20px;}
.Whatsapp-bt{position:fixed;bottom:40px;right:15px;z-index:100;display:block;}
.bg-black{background-color:rgba(0,0,0,0.3);color:var(--branco);z-index:1;height:inherit;width:100%;display:flex;justify-content:center; align-items:center;flex-direction:column;}
.header-interna{height:280px;width:100%;overflow:hidden;background-repeat:no-repeat;background-size:cover;background-position:center center;}.header-interna h1{margin:0px;padding:15px 8px;text-align:center;width:100%;text-shadow: 2px 2px 2px rgba(0, 0, 0, 1);}
.curiosidade-bloco2{margin-left:-80px;padding-top:150px;}
.box-lp-img{position:absolute;top:-25px;}

@media only screen and (max-width:640px){
.Main{width:100%;overflow-x:hidden;}
.MenuMob{display:block;}
.flex-content-cardapio-wrapper,.flex-content-footer,.flex-content-A,.flex-content-B,.flex-content-C,.flex-content-txt,.flex-content-dicas-img{flex-direction:column;}
.flex-content-dicas-img div:nth-child(1){width:100%;text-align:center;margin-bottom:15px;}
.flex-content-A .wd-600{width:99%;}
.flex-content-cardapio-wrapper{width:100%}
.flex-content-cardapio-wrapper.justify-between{justify-content:center;align-items:center;}
.cardapio-box{margin:0px 6px 25px;}
.nav-wrapper{position:fixed;width:0px;background-color:rgba(0,0,0,0.8);top:0px;left:0px;height:100vh;overflow:hidden;z-index:99;}
.nav{width:42%;background-color:var(--branco);flex-direction:column;justify-content:flex-start;align-items:flex-start;height:100vh;}
.nav.font-size18{font-size:16px;}
.nav-item{padding:8px 20px;border-bottom:solid 1px;width:100%;}
.logomarca-mob{width:100%;text-align:center;width:100%;padding:20px 5px;}
.logomarca-mob img{width:120px;}
.redes-mob{text-align:center;width:100%;margin:10px 5px 20px;}
.redes-mob div{display:inline-block;width:30px;}
.closebt{position:absolute; right:12px; top:15px;padding:8px 4px;color:var(--branco);display:block;}
.Main-Img{flex-direction:column;}
.Main-Img div:nth-child(1){order:2;width:100%;}
.Main-Img div:nth-child(2){order:1;width:100%;}
#mainimg,.img-coxinha{display:none;}
#mainimg-mob{display:block;}
.MenuMob::after{content:'Menu';color:var(--laranja);position: absolute;top:38px;left:-5px;display:block;font-size:14px;font-family:'Signika',sans-serif;text-transform:uppercase;}
.flex-content-footer.justify-between{justify-content:center;align-items:center;}
.flex-content-footer div{text-align:center;}
.bt-branco,.bt-laranja,.bt-vermelho,.bt{margin-bottom:15px;}
.Main-Img .font-size25{font-size:18px;}
.Main-Img .font-size40{font-size:32px;}
.Main-Img .font-size32{font-size:25px;}
.redes-top{margin-top:5px;}
.header-interna{height:200px;}
.header-interna .font-size32{font-size:25px;}
.chamada.font-size25,.flex-content-txt.font-size25{font-size:18px;}
.curiosidade-bloco1{display:none;}
.curiosidade-bloco2{margin-left:0px;padding-top:10px;}
.box-lp-img{position:relative;top:5px;margin-bottom:20px;}
[id^=accordion]:checked ~ .accordion-content {
    height: 215px!important;
}
}

@media only screen and (max-width:460px){
.nav{width:60%;background-color:var(--branco);flex-direction:column;justify-content:flex-start;align-items:flex-start;height:100vh;}
}


.accordions{
    width:100%;
    margin:0 auto;
}
.accordion-item input{
	display:none;
}
.accordion-item label{
    display:block;
    background:var(--bege-medio);
    cursor:pointer;
	padding:5px 3px;
    font-family:'Signika',sans-serif;
}
.accordion-content{
    height: 0px;
    overflow: hidden;
    transition: height 0.3s ease-in-out;
    font-family:'Signika',sans-serif;
 }
[id^=accordion]:checked ~ .accordion-content {
    height: 100px;
    transition: height 0.3s ease-in-out;
    padding: 10px;
}

